Shadow Knights
Summary
Shadow Knights is a video game[1]. It ranks in the top 6% of video_game ent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(31 views/month).[2]
Key Facts
- Shadow Knights's instance of is recorded as video game[3].
- Shadow Knights's publisher is recorded as Softdisk[4].
- Shadow Knights's genre is recorded as platform game[5].
- Shadow Knights's developer is recorded as id Software[6].
- Shadow Knights's designed by is recorded as John Carmack[7].
- Shadow Knights's platform is recorded as DOS[8].
- Shadow Knights's game mode is recorded as single-player video game[9].
- Shadow Knights's distribution format is recorded as floppy disk[10].
- Shadow Knights's input device is recorded as computer keyboard[11].
- Shadow Knights's country of origin is recorded as United States[12].
